Default Valve covers???

OK, so my car is getting ever closer to the point of being on the road. I am having trouble with interference of the old crappy Moroso tall valve covers I had for the race car to the heater-A/C box on the right side. I had tall covers because I ran a stud girdle, and planned to use it again just because I have it. The valve cover on the RS won't fit, even with NO gasket.

What are you all using for valve covers? I guess I can get rid of the girdle, as this motor will see only street duty with an occasional trip down the track. Do Mickey Thompson covers fit? I always liked them.

I have seen cast aluminum spacers under stock covers for guys running taller-than-stock valvetrains.

IIRC they are about 1.5" tall.

Check with PY too, but I think Indian Adventures makes (?) and sells them.
